Transaction 717ab5641d600070f9b105dbe0cdc1be10990499130d829e61b2fcbc16130de6

2 Input
2 Outputs
  • 717ab5641d600070f9b105dbe0cdc1be10990499130d829e61b2fcbc16130de6:0
  • value  1116186
    address  3CBVm6d9HF21FkA1SAQ6C2cM7B3sb1WE7t
  • 717ab5641d600070f9b105dbe0cdc1be10990499130d829e61b2fcbc16130de6:1
  • value  401870
    address  14qqEn17RfUePyxoLFBLUq8ptpVB1wuffh